WebJan 8, 2024 · Chapter: 24 Direct and Indirect Speech. Direct Speech. Aman said, “I am ill today.”. In this sentence, the very words of the speaker, i.e., “I am ill today” are quoted. within inverted commas (” “). This is called the Direct Speech. The sentence within ” ” is called reported speech.
